Abstract
In this work, we take the with as a glueball consists of three valence gluons, and construct a six-quark current based on rigorous current-field duality to obtain the glueball-quark Lagrangian. Then we perform Fierz transformation to bosonize the quark current into a series of three pseudoscalar mesons. At last, we obtain ratios among the partial decay widths of the glueball to three pseudoscalar mesons in a model-independent way, which are compatible with the experimental data from the BESIII Collaboration and support assigning the as a glueball.
